The Health and Safety Executive (HSE) and Safeguard client British Sugar have formalised a longstanding partnership by signing a memorandum of understanding aimed at reducing accident and ill-health risks in the workplace.
The agreement marks a significant milestone in the partnership between HSE and British Sugar UK and recognises improvements to the company’s safety performance over the last five years.
In it, HSE agrees to support British Sugar UK in its pledge to continue to develop proportionate and sensible risk control systems and to improve its Health and Safety performance. British Sugar UK commits to championing the drive to improve workplace protections by striving to be an exemplar in occupational Health and Safety.
Gino De Jaegher, Managing Director, UK & Ireland, British Sugar commented: “I am extremely proud of British Sugar being recognised by the Health and Safety Executive. Health and Safety is of critical importance to our business and our people, and supports our vision to eliminate all injuries by thinking safety first in everything we do.”
